The Cradle Carry
Age: Newborn through 35 lbs.
Benefits: Provides good support and a womb-like atmosphere for newborns, cuddling and nap time for older babies.
Variations: Baby can be sitting semi-upright or cradled deeper in the pouch horizontally.
Tips: For premature babies or babies younger than four months you can provide extra spinal support and elevation by positioning a folded towel or receiving blanket in the carrier.
